2.1.3 存储引擎层(行存、列存、内存引擎)


文档摘要

2.1.3 存储引擎层(行存、列存、内存引擎) 2.1.3 存储引擎层(行存、列存、内存引擎) 在现代数据库系统中,存储引擎是决定性能、扩展性与适用场景的核心组件。如果说查询优化器是大脑,事务管理器是心脏,那么存储引擎就是骨骼与肌肉——它直接决定了数据如何被写入磁盘、如何被读取、如何在内存与持久化介质之间流转。在“整体架构分层模型”的语境下,存储引擎层位于物理存储之上、执行引擎之下,承担着将逻辑数据结构映射为高效物理布局的重任。 当前主流的存储引擎主要分为三类:行式存储(Row-Oriented Storage)、列式存储(Column-Oriented Storage) 和 内存引擎(In-Memory Engine)。它们并非相互排斥,而是在不同工作负载下各展所长。


发布者: 作者: 转发
评论区 (0)
U